Michael K. Urban, M.D., Ph.D.
Attending Anesthesiologist
Dr. Michael Urban is a board-certified anesthesiologist who has specialized in Cardiac Anesthesia since 1988. He is a teaching professional who has written numerous publications and abstracts. He is a member of the dedicated spine team at HSS. Dr. Urban has been the Director of the Acute Pain Service since 1992.

Current Research
- Humeral mediators of physiological changes after major orthopedic and spine surgery; the fat embolism syndrome.
- Management of coagulopathies and blood conservation during complex spine surgery.
- Perioperative myocardial ischemia: incidence in high risk patients. relationship to outcome and prevention.
